Are you interested in a career in capital markets? If so, then a junior analyst position in Toronto, Canada may be a great option for you. As a junior analyst in the capital markets, you will be responsible for analyzing financial data, researching market trends, and providing advice to clients. You will also be responsible for preparing reports and presentations. In order to be successful in this role, it is important to have a solid understanding of the financial markets, financial models, and analysis techniques. A strong background in mathematics, economics, finance, or accounting is also beneficial. Additionally, a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A) certification can be beneficial as well. The CFA is one of the most sought-after qualifications for a junior analyst position in Toronto. It is a highly respected designation and can open up many doors for you in the capital markets. In order to obtain the CFA designation, you must complete a series of three exams. After passing these exams, you will receive your CFA certification. Once you have obtained your CFA, you can begin searching for junior analyst capital markets jobs in Toronto. There are many opportunities available in the city, ranging from small independent firms to large banks and other financial institutions. With your CFA certification, you will have a better chance of getting hired and advancing in your career. When applying for junior analyst capital markets jobs in Toronto, it is important to be aware of the job requirements. You should have a strong understanding of financial markets and be able to analyze financial data and market trends. You should also have strong problem solving skills and be able to work with a team. Additionally, excellent communication and presentation skills are essential. In order to be successful in your job, you should stay up to date with the latest developments in the capital markets. You should also be willing to work long hours and be flexible to the ever-changing nature of the markets. If you are looking to start a career in the capital markets in Toronto, then a junior analyst position is a great option. With your CFA certification and strong financial acumen, you will have a better chance at succeeding in this role.

Portland, also known as the City of Roses, is the largest city in the state of Oregon, United States. The city is known for its vibrant atmosphere, diverse culture, and thriving economy. One of the most important sectors of the Portland economy is the housing industry. The housing industry in Portland is supported by the Portland Housing Authority, which provides affordable housing solutions to low-income families and individuals in the city. The Portland Housing Authority (PHA) is a governmental agency that was established in 1941 to address the housing needs of low-income families and individuals in Portland. The PHA is responsible for managing and operating several affordable housing programs in the city, including public housing, Section 8 housing, and affordable housing development programs. The PHA’s mission is to provide safe, decent, and affordable housing to the residents of Portland. The PHA provides several job opportunities for individuals interested in working in the affordable housing industry. The agency employs professionals in various fields, including property management, social work, maintenance, accounting, and administration. The agency offers competitive salaries, benefits packages, and opportunities for career growth and advancement. One of the most popular job opportunities offered by the PHA is property management. Property managers are responsible for managing the day-to-day operations of affordable housing properties owned by the PHA. Property managers are responsible for ensuring that the properties are well-maintained, residents are satisfied, and the properties are in compliance with local, state, and federal regulations. Another popular job opportunity offered by the PHA is social work. Social workers employed by the PHA work with low-income families and individuals to help them secure affordable housing. Social workers provide counseling, case management, and advocacy services to help families and individuals overcome barriers to housing. Maintenance positions are also available at the PHA. Maintenance workers are responsible for performing routine maintenance and repairs on affordable housing properties owned by the PHA. Maintenance workers ensure that the properties are in good condition and that residents are living in safe and comfortable homes. Accounting and administration positions are also available at the PHA. These positions are responsible for managing the finances and administrative functions of the agency. Accounting and administration professionals ensure that the agency is operating efficiently and in compliance with all applicable laws and regulations. Working for the PHA is a rewarding experience for individuals interested in making a difference in the lives of low-income families and individuals in Portland. The agency offers a supportive work environment, competitive salaries, and opportunities for career growth and advancement. Malaysia has been known for its oil and gas industry, which has been one of the country's main sources of income. The oil and gas industry is a highly sought-after field that requires a diverse range of skill sets and expertise. It is also one of the most lucrative industries in the world, with many opportunities for growth and development. This is why many fresh graduates in Malaysia are looking for oil and gas jobs. The oil and gas industry is vast, and it includes several sub-sectors such as exploration, drilling, production, transportation, and refining. Each of these sub-sectors requires different skill sets and expertise, and there are several job opportunities available for fresh graduates in each of these sub-sectors. Exploration Exploration is the first stage of the oil and gas industry. It involves searching for oil and gas reserves, evaluating their potential, and determining their commercial viability. Exploration jobs require a strong understanding of geology, geophysics, and other related fields. Fresh graduates with degrees in geology, geophysics, or petroleum engineering can find job opportunities in this sub-sector. Drilling Drilling is the next stage of the oil and gas industry. It involves the process of drilling wells to extract oil and gas reserves. Drilling jobs require a strong knowledge of drilling techniques, equipment, and safety procedures. Fresh graduates with degrees in mechanical engineering, electrical engineering, or petroleum engineering can find job opportunities in this sub-sector. Production Production is the stage where oil and gas are extracted from the wells and transported to refineries. Production jobs require a strong knowledge of production techniques, equipment, and safety procedures. Fresh graduates with degrees in chemical engineering, mechanical engineering, or petroleum engineering can find job opportunities in this sub-sector. Transportation Transportation involves transporting oil and gas from production sites to refineries and other destinations. Transportation jobs require a strong knowledge of logistics, supply chain management, and safety procedures. Fresh graduates with degrees in logistics, supply chain management, or business administration can find job opportunities in this sub-sector. Refining Refining is the final stage of the oil and gas industry. It involves the process of refining crude oil into various products such as gasoline, diesel, and jet fuel. Refining jobs require a strong knowledge of refining techniques, equipment, and safety procedures. Fresh graduates with degrees in chemical engineering or mechanical engineering can find job opportunities in this sub-sector. Salary and Benefits Oil and gas jobs in Malaysia offer competitive salaries and benefits. The salary for fresh graduates varies depending on the job title and the sub-sector. However, the average salary for fresh graduates in the oil and gas industry in Malaysia is around RM3,500 to RM4,000 per month.
